Because of your support, my school counseling office has become a place where students experiencing homelessness or living in foster care can have their most basic needs met with dignity and ease.\r\n\r\nWe are using the donated snacks and toiletries every single day. The snacks are openly available, and students now know they can stop by when they're feeling hungry and struggling to focus in class. One student recently shared that having a snack before heading back to class helped them \"finally feel calm enough to think.\" Moments like these happen often now, and they matter deeply. Thanks to your generosity, I no longer have to ration snacks. Instead, students are empowered to choose what they need on any given day, which has strengthened our connection and increased how often students check in with me for support.\r\n\r\nHaving the hygiene items visibly available has been especially powerful. In the past, it was difficult to identify when students needed hygiene items, as those conversations can feel uncomfortable or stigmatizing. By displaying these items openly, it has normalized conversations around basic needs and made it easier for students to name barriers—like lack of toiletries—that interfere with their ability to attend school regularly and confidently.\r\n\r\nYour contribution has helped transform my office into the safe space I've been working to create. When students know their basic needs will be met, they are more willing to engage in counseling, talk about academic challenges, and plan next steps for their education. Thank you for giving my students comfort, choice, and dignity. About this school
Maywood Academy High School is
a suburban public school
in Maywood, California that is part of Los Angeles Unified School District.
It serves 1,002 students
in grades 9 - 12 with a student/teacher ratio of 20.4:1.
Its teachers have had 45 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
